Transaction 3336df63eea358029a2b12aa511648212034fd91c49068b1eae2283dd2c8351b

1 Input
2 Outputs
  • 3336df63eea358029a2b12aa511648212034fd91c49068b1eae2283dd2c8351b:0
  • value  6350000
    address  3K6xzqYn99sd6hRBrAakWpD6dzTTumhodj
  • 3336df63eea358029a2b12aa511648212034fd91c49068b1eae2283dd2c8351b:1
  • value  16785716
    address  3KcPGEcPWNby9ez1GgvfWRgKH9adMDGVuq